I'm still in shock—maybe even haunted—over everything that happened in this book. I found myself in a constant state of fear for the characters, even after it ended, even after it's been a week since I finished it. 
Although they were victorious, I didn't feel like celebrating. There were just far too many lost and ruined lives. Finnick's and Prim's death pained me the most. They were my favorites, and they had so much of life post-Hunger Games to look forward to. I appreciated that Katniss didn't let Coin take over. She was too close on the road that Snow took—maybe even already there, only framed a little bit differently.
